Modern Applications of Naming
In modern life, selecting a name goes beyond adhering to traditions or cultural norms. Naming trends reflect societal changes and aspirations. Here are some vital considerations: 1. Cultural Influence
The naming landscape has diversified with globalization. Contemporary parents often choose names reflecting personal meaning, cultural heritage, and modern trends. For instance:
| Trend | Description | Example Names |
| Nature-inspired | Drawing from natural elements | River, Sky, Forest |
| Vintage revival | Rediscovering classic names | Oliver, Henry, Evelyn |
| Unique spellings | Altering traditional names | Jaxon, Zayden, Aiden |
| Globalization | Incorporating multicultural elements | Kai, Luca, Emiliano |

Changes in Naming Trends and Fortune Predictions
Recent years have ushered in a blend of tradition and modernity in naming practices, with a marked shift towards gender-neutral names while some cultures continue to adhere strictly to historical conventions.
Shifts Towards Gender Neutrality The rise of gender-neutral names represents a significant cultural shift, breaking away from rigid binary structures. Names like Avery, Riley, and Jordan have emerged as popular choices for boys, reflecting a broader societal acceptance of fluid identities.
Predicting Future Trends
| Future Trend | Key Features | Potential Popular Names |
| Increased Unique Names | Customization to reflect individuality | Zander, Kael, Sloane |
| Eco-centric Names | Focus on environmental awareness | Ash, River, Cedar |
| Historical Roots | Drawing upon character names from history or mythology | Atticus, Orion, Seraphim |
